The role of nitrogen in automobiles
1.Enhance tire stability and comfort. Nitrogen is nearly inert as a diatomic gas, with extremely inactive chemical properties. Its gas molecules are larger than oxygen molecules, making it less prone to thermal expansion and contraction, resulting in smaller deformation. The rate at which nitrogen permeates the tire's sidewall is approximately slower than that of air.30~40%, Maintains consistent tire pressure, enhancing tire stability during travel, ensuring driving comfort; nitrogen has low audio conductivity, equivalent to that of ordinary air.1/5Using nitrogen can effectively reduce tire noise and enhance driving tranquility.
2.Prevent blowouts and tire flattening. A blowout is the number one cause of highway traffic accidents. Statistics show that on highways, there is...46%The traffic accident was caused by a tire failure, with tire blowouts accounting for a significant portion of the total tire accidents.70%During vehicle operation, tire temperature increases due to friction with the ground, especially at high speeds and during emergency braking. This rapid rise in internal gas temperature within the tire can cause a sudden increase in tire pressure, leading to the possibility of a blowout. High temperatures also accelerate tire rubber aging, reduce fatigue strength, and cause severe tread wear, which are significant factors contributing to blowouts. In comparison to standard compressed air, high-purity nitrogen, being oxygen-free and nearly moisture and oil-free, has a lower thermal expansion coefficient and thermal conductivity, heats up slower, and does not ignite or support combustion. These characteristics greatly reduce the likelihood of a blowout.
3.Extend tire lifespan After using nitrogen, tire pressure remains stable with minimal volume changes, significantly reducing the likelihood of irregular tire wear, such as crown wear, shoulder wear, and side wear, thereby extending the tire's lifespan. The aging of rubber is caused by oxidation from oxygen molecules in the air, leading to a decrease in strength and elasticity and cracking. This is one of the reasons for the shortened lifespan of tires. Nitrogen separation devices can effectively remove oxygen, sulfur, oil, water, and other impurities from the air to a great extent, reducing the oxidation of the tire liner and the corrosion of rubber, preventing metal wheel corrosion, extending the tire's lifespan, and to some extent, reducing wheel rust.
4.Reduce fuel consumption and protect the environment. Insufficient tire pressure and increased rolling resistance due to heat can lead to higher fuel consumption during driving; however, nitrogen not only maintains stable tire pressure and delays pressure drop, but also, due to its dryness and lack of oil and water, low thermal conductivity, and slow warming, it reduces the temperature rise of the tire during movement and minimizes tire deformation to improve traction, thereby lowering rolling resistance and achieving the goal of reducing fuel consumption.
Handling Instructions
Toxicity and Protection
1、 Respiratory Protection: Generally, no special protection is required. However, when the oxygen concentration in the workplace air is below18%At all times, air breathing apparatus, oxygen breathing apparatus, or a long tube mask must be worn.
2、 Eye Protection: Wear a safety face shield.
3、 Other Protection: Avoid inhaling high concentrations in confined spaces; ensure good natural ventilation. Operators must undergo specialized training and strictly adhere to operational procedures. Prevent gas leakage into the workplace air. Handle with care to prevent damage to cylinders and accessories. Equip with emergency leak response equipment.
Fire Emergency Measures and Protection
Evacuate personnel from the leak pollution area to the upwind area immediately and isolate them, strictly control entry and exit. It is recommended that emergency personnel wear self-contained positive pressure breathing apparatus. Avoid direct contact with the leaked material. Try to cut off the source of the leak. Prevent the accumulation of gas in low-lying areas, which may ignite and explode upon contact with an ignition source. Use exhaust fans to disperse the leaked gas to open spaces. Properly dispose of the leaking container, repair and inspect it before reuse.
This product is non-flammable. Use foggy water to cool the container in the fire scene. Spray foggy water to accelerate the evaporation of liquid nitrogen, but do not use a water jet to spray at the liquid nitrogen.
